Exhaust smell in the cabin ('90 LS400, 160k)
I used to have the "check engine" light on intermittently for months now. A few weeks ago, I replaced the EGR modulator (cleaning it did nothing), and the light never came back on. Also, my MPG improved a bit.
However, now for a few days in a row, I have been feeling some exhaust smell in the car, even if I put the vents on "recirculate". What would be the most likely culprit - EGR pipe probably? I don't have the "check engine" light on, and I thought it would come on if the pipe broke... Since I have not replaced my engine mounts yet even though I have the OEMs sitting right here, (too much to do, too little time), I suspect that all that stress and vibrations finally did a number to the EGR pipe.
Should I just order a new pipe, and have it replaced? I mean, I never heard of the exhaust going bad on these babies... but everyone seems to have had the EGR pipe break at least once.

no, it is likely your lower EGR pipe, look in the crinkled part in the bend of the pipe, that is where they crack, and you would definitely smell exhaust fumes, as the fresh air intake is just 18 inches or so above this pipe!
the replacement Toyota part is about $100 if you shop it online, and it is no fun to install!
